Field Operations Manager
Lead our elite restoration teams and define the standard for stone craftsmanship in the field.
The Role
As our Field Operations Manager, you aren't just a supervisor: you are the heartbeat of our field execution. You will lead technicians in the field, coordinate complex jobs, manage materials, and ensure every project meets our rigorous standards. This is a hands-on leadership role that involves being on the ground, directing crews, and working alongside them in the delicate arts of polishing, repairing, and sealing high-end stone surfaces.
What You Bring
Expert Craftsmanship
5+ years in stone restoration or related trades with mastery in polishing and honing.
Proven Leadership
2+ years managing field crews and overseeing job site safety and logistics.
Bilingual Communication
Fluency in both English and Spanish is required to lead our diverse teams effectively.
Tech-Savvy & Organized
Ability to manage digital schedules, material inventories, and reporting tools.
